Which NWS forecast zone is Franklin County in?

Franklin County, Ohio is NWS county code OHC049 and forecast zone OHZ055. Alerts for it are issued by the Wilmington (ILN) Weather Forecast Office, and the nearest NEXRAD radar is KILN.
